The brief

Bedford Borough Council requires the construction of Changing Places in two locations, Russell Park as a new stand-alone unit and at The Higgins Art Gallery and Museum as an adaptation of current space.

Unitary and district councils were invited by the Department for Levelling Up, Housing and Commuities in July 2021 to submit expressions of interest for funding to create new Changing Places Toilet facilities to improve access for severely disabled people and their carers.

There are around 1,300 registered CPTs in England but demand is outstripping supply and the number of CPTs needs to increase.

Following a funding decision by DLUHC, the Council was awarded the total grant funding requested intended to cover capital costs associated with the installation of the two CPT facilities.

The Changing Places facility is designed so that they are completely accessible and provide sufficient space and equipment for people who are not able to use the toilet independently.

Changing Places Toilets must meet particular specifications and be registered with the Changing Places UK Consortium on completion, via Muscular Dystrophy UK (MDUK) Changing Places Support Officers.
